About Neptune, an Ash Hotel

Featuring North Restaurant, cocktail lounge and karaoke lounge, Neptune, an Ash Hotel is located in Providence city center. Free WiFi access is available. A flat-screen TV is provided in each air-conditioned guest room. Neptune, an Ash Hotel has a 24-hour front desk. Luggage stories and laundry facilities are also available. This property is located within walking distance of many college campuses. University of Rhode Island Providence is 3 minutes' walk away. Johnson & Wales University is 1476 feet away. Rhode Island School of Design is 2461 feet away. Brown University is 0.7 mi away. Roger Williams University is 31 minutes' drive away.

Where is Neptune, an Ash Hotel located, and how walkable is the area?
Neptune, an Ash Hotel is located at 122 Fountain Street, Providence, RI 02903. With a Walk Score of 91, the area is rated Walker's Paradise. Most daily errands can be done on foot — ideal for travelers without a car.
